Add 7/40 and 70/45
1st number: 7/40, 2nd number: 1 25/45
7/40 + 70/45 is 623/360.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 40 and 45 is 360
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 360 - For the 1st fraction, since 40 × 9 = 360,
7/40 = 7 × 9/40 × 9 = 63/360 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 45 × 8 = 360,
70/45 = 70 × 8/45 × 8 = 560/360 - Add the two like fractions:
63/360 + 560/360 = 63 + 560/360 = 623/360 - So, 7/40 + 70/45 = 623/360
